The Asthma Score in 13060, Elbridge, New York is 76 out of 100 when comparing 34,000 ZIP Codes in the United States.
74.28 percent of the population in 13060 drive to work alone. 0.28 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 62.40 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 6.96 percent of the residents in 13060 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 2.03 members with about 2.10 cars available per household.
An estimate of 97.17 percent of the residents in 13060 has some form of health insurance. 45.83 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 75.69 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.
A resident in 13060 would have to travel an average of 8.87 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Auburn Community Hospital .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 13060, Elbridge, New York.

As of , an estimate of 2,723 residents live in 13060 with a median age of 47.2 years. 21.19 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 18.44 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 38.90 percent of the residents in 13060 is currently married, and 20.32 percent of the population has never been married.
The monthly median household income in 13060 is $4,579.58.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 13060 is approximately $880. The median household spends about 19.22 percent of their income on housing.

For those contemplating a move to 13060, understanding the area's history can provide valuable insights into its character and appeal. Elbridge was established in 1794 and named after Elbridge Gerry, the fifth Vice President of the United States. With its roots in agriculture and industry, the town has evolved into a residential area while retaining its small-town charm.
